At Victory Arts Foundation, every child is celebrated for their unique abilities, creativity, and spirit. On 12th September, our special kids, who are part of Victory’s inclusive dance classes across various venues, experienced an unforgettable day at the Museum of Solutions (MuSo) in Mumbai.

From the moment they stepped into MuSo, the children were immersed in a world of imagination and exploration. Each exhibit and interactive space invited them to discover, play, and express themselves freely. It was heartwarming to watch their faces light up as they engaged with the museum — learning, laughing, and spreading their boundless joy through every corner.

For our Victory kids, dance has always been a powerful way of expressing themselves and building confidence. At MuSo, they found another stage — one where curiosity, creativity, and collaboration were celebrated. The experience beautifully aligned with our belief that art, play, and learning are essential in nurturing confidence, inclusivity, and self-expression.

We are deeply grateful to the MuSo team for their warm hospitality and for creating an environment that was not only accessible but also truly magical for our children. Their thoughtful curation ensured that every child felt seen, valued, and included — making this visit a memorable chapter in their journey with Victory Arts Foundation.

This day was a reminder that when given the right spaces and opportunities, every child shines in their own extraordinary way. And at Victory, we remain committed to creating those opportunities — whether through dance, art, or experiences like these — that empower our children to grow, express, and inspire.
